Six priority development areas

According to the technological development trend of the world chemical industry, the following six areas will be focused on during the Eleventh Five-Year Plan period.

● Agrochemicals

In the chemical fertilizer industry, nitrogen fertilizer will focus on the development of new coal gasification technology, new purification technology, energy-saving ammonia synthesis technology, water solution full cycle urea modification technology, urea modification technology, nitrogen fertilizer co-production of methanol, dimethyl ether and other energy and chemical technologies. Phosphate fertilizer will develop large-scale production technology of phosphate compound fertilizer, circular economy technology in the process of phosphate fertilizer production and industrialization technology of comprehensive utilization of low-grade phosphate rock. Potash fertilizer will focus on the development of large-scale new technologies for the production of potassium chloride, potassium sulfate and potassium nitrate, and comprehensive utilization technologies such as lithium extraction from salt lakes.

Chemical mines develop advanced mining technology and mineral processing technology to solve the problem of difficult mining and separation of medium and low grade collophane; Pyrite focuses on solving the serious environmental pollution caused by a large number of by-products in the process of sulfuric acid production from pyrite, and developing the comprehensive utilization technology of pyrite cinder in sulfuric acid production.

The focus of pesticide science and technology innovation in pesticide industry is to strengthen the development and transformation of original innovative products based on biological rationality and develop green key technologies in the process of pesticide production and use. The key varieties to be developed are: new varieties to replace highly toxic organophosphorus pesticides and underground pest control agents, new fungicides and virus inhibitors and nematicides for fruits and vegetables, herbicides suitable for light farming on water and new herbicides for dry fields.

● New coal chemical industry and natural gas chemical industry

To develop new coal chemical industry and natural gas chemical industry, we should concentrate on breaking through key technologies such as coal coking, coal gasification, coal liquefaction, natural gas conversion, purification and catalytic synthesis.

The 11th Five-Year Plan focuses on the development and implementation of coal coking technology, large-scale coal gasification technology and "polygeneration" technology with coal gasification as the core, complete sets of large-scale natural gas steam conversion technology, industrialization technology of carbon-1 chemical products and large-scale coal liquefaction technology.

● New chemical materials

At present, China's chemical new materials industry is relatively backward, and there is a big gap with foreign countries, which is mainly manifested in backward production technology, small scale, high cost and obvious product quality fluctuation. Many varieties that have been mass-produced abroad cannot be industrialized in China.

In the 11th Five-Year Plan, the development focuses on general plastics modification technology, engineering plastics industrialization technology, engineering plastics high-performance technology, high-performance radial tire industrialization technology, large-scale synthetic rubber industrialization technology, rubber composite materials and new rubber processing additives industrialization technology, functional polymer materials, new fluorosilicone materials and new inorganic functional materials.

● Fine chemical industry

China fine chemical industry should strengthen independent innovation, break through core catalytic technology, modern reaction engineering technology and fine processing technology, and develop environment-friendly technology.

The focus of technology development and industrialization in the Eleventh Five-Year Plan is the green synthesis technology and new varieties of functional coatings and waterborne coatings, new dyes and their industrialization technology, important chemical intermediates, electronic chemicals, high-performance water treatment chemicals, paper chemicals, oilfield chemicals, functional food additives, high-performance environmental protection flame retardants, surfactants and high-performance rubber and plastic additives.

● chlor-alkali industry

At present, China's chlor-alkali industry is developing well, but the existing problems are still very prominent.

"Eleventh Five-Year Plan" will focus on reducing energy consumption, realizing scale and refinement, and focus on developing and popularizing: domestic ion-exchange membrane caustic soda technology; Application technology of expansion anode and modified diaphragm: optimization technology of PVC modification and polymerization process: development of ten thousand tons three-phase flow evaporator: development of high-speed natural forced circulation evaporator: popularization of sliding vane high-pressure chlorine compressor; Production technology of downstream products with chlorine and hydrogen as raw materials, etc.

● Chemical equipment

The problems to be solved urgently in the research and development of major chemical equipment in China are: insufficient independent innovation research and development ability and low overall level of technical equipment.

During the Eleventh Five-Year Plan period, firstly, advanced technologies such as pulverized coal gasification and low-pressure carbonylation of methanol to acetic acid with independent intellectual property rights in China will be transformed into productive forces as soon as possible; Second, further strengthen the research and development of complete sets of equipment for engineering radial tires, and strive to improve the production technology level of engineering radial tires in China; The third is to develop a number of advanced chemical equipment to meet the needs of chemical production.

Six key technologies to promote development

Chemical industry is a technology-intensive industry, and it needs a lot of technical support to solve many problems in chemical production. "Eleventh Five-Year Plan" and even a period in the future, China's chemical industry needs to focus on developing the following six key technologies.

■ New catalytic technology

Catalytic technology has always been one of the most important key technologies in chemical industry. There is still a certain gap between China's catalytic technology and foreign countries.

During the Eleventh Five-Year Plan period, we will focus on the development of oil refining catalysis technology, fine chemical catalysis technology, synthetic ammonia industrial catalysis technology, carbon-chemical catalysis technology, polymer catalysis technology, nano-catalysis technology, biocatalysis technology, photocatalytic technology and new catalytic materials.

■ New separation technology

Separation technology is an important technology in chemical industry. Compared with foreign advanced countries, China's separation technology lags behind foreign countries by about 10 years.

The focus of the Eleventh Five-Year Plan is to develop distillation technology in petroleum refining, petrochemical industry and the production of bulk organic chemical products; Catalytic distillation technology of esterification, transesterification, saponification, amination, hydrolysis, isomerization, alkylation, halogenation, acetylation and nitration; Membrane separation technology for industrial gas purification and chemical wastewater treatment; Molecular distillation technology for separating heat-sensitive chemical products: high gravity technology in fine chemical production: efficient crystallization technology for inorganic salts, fertilizers and soda ash production.

■ Biochemical technology

China's biochemical technology started in the early 1980s, and has achieved many industrialization achievements so far, but there is still a big gap compared with industrialized countries.

The development of biocatalysis technology in the Eleventh Five-Year Plan focuses on the research of bioreactor, high-efficiency biological separation technology and equipment, and coupling technology of biological reaction and separation, so as to expand the sources of biocatalysts and enzymes. The main products are: bioenergy, biomaterials, organic acids, amino acids and functional food additives.

■ Automatic control and information technology

The application of information technology in China's chemical industry has just begun, and its development is not balanced at present.

"Eleventh Five-Year Plan" focuses on ERP technology of large-scale chemical and petrochemical enterprises, and promotes the application of automatic scientific and technological achievements in fertilizer, petrochemical and chlor-alkali production processes; Develop and improve various optimization techniques. The specific contents are: computer control, fault diagnosis and simulation technology; Computer molecular design technology; Computer artificial intelligence technology; Develop chemical e-commerce and carry out e-commerce network activities at home and abroad.

■ Nanotechnology

Compared with foreign countries, the production cost of nano-products in China is high, and the stability of powder structure and properties is poor; The research and development of nano-material application technology is still in its infancy.

During the Eleventh Five-Year Plan period, we will focus on developing some key technologies for the large-scale production of nano-powders, such as nano-catalysis technology, application technology of nano-materials in coatings, application technology of nano-materials in the modification of polymer materials such as rubber, plastics and chemical fibers, and application technology of nano-materials in the fields of energy, environment, resources and water treatment.

■ Cleaner production technology and energy-saving technology

High energy consumption and high pollution are still "bottlenecks" restricting the development of chemical industry in China. Developing circular economy and establishing conservation-oriented industry is one of the key tasks of China chemical industry at present.

"Eleventh Five-Year Plan" focuses on the development of clean production technology of bulk chemical products and fine chemicals, high-concentration refractory organic wastewater treatment technology, solid waste recycling technology and industrial tail gas purification and recovery technology; In terms of energy saving, we will focus on developing and popularizing efficient combustion technology, efficient evaporation and spray drying technology, steam condensate recovery technology, heat pipe technology and heat pump technology.
